Why Is Fast Emergency Tree Removal So Important in Clermont?

Getting a dangerous tree removed quickly in Clermont isn't just about cleaning up. An unstable or fallen tree can cause ongoing damage to your roof, foundation, or even underground utilities if left unchecked. Heavy rains can also make fallen branches heavier and more difficult to move, increasing the risk of further property damage or injury.

Our local weather, especially during hurricane season, means trees can fail without much warning. High winds and saturated ground are a bad combination for even healthy trees. Prompt removal prevents secondary issues like mold growth from water intrusion if a roof is compromised, or pest infestations in decaying wood near your home.

Also, a downed tree can block access to your property or create a serious safety hazard for anyone walking by. We clear the danger so you can get back to normal, without worrying about what might happen next. It's about protecting your biggest investment and keeping everyone safe.

If a tree falls on your house in Clermont, first ensure everyone is safe and evacuate if necessary. Call 911 if there's an immediate threat like downed power lines or gas leaks. Then, contact your insurance company to report the damage. After that, call us for emergency tree removal. Do not try to remove the tree yourself, as it can be extremely dangerous.
